#2108d4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2108d4 is composed of 12.9% red, 3.1%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.4% cyan, 96.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 247.4 degrees, a saturation of 92.7% and a lightness of 43.1%. #2108d4 color hex could be obtained by blending #4210ff with #0000a9.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

Shades and Tints of #2108d4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010004 is the darkest color, while #f2f0f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#2108d4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e6e6e is the less saturated color, while #2108d4 is the most saturated one.
